Transaction 071020c6c8e060cf36bde0a8da2bf7a423c808382ffafdee1a7cf558e433b9e8

1 Input
2 Outputs
  • 071020c6c8e060cf36bde0a8da2bf7a423c808382ffafdee1a7cf558e433b9e8:0
  • value  16241178
    address  35AGGDFqXiaKoYEK8XwLyV1hbiQcLbzYNR
  • 071020c6c8e060cf36bde0a8da2bf7a423c808382ffafdee1a7cf558e433b9e8:1
  • value  2451759
    address  1HFEJgYapz3tw3V3oVSopKgCKeTcqovcy8